Cadet Scrap is a Batwoman fanfic written by Caivu, set during Kate Kane's final semester at West Point about a week before her resignation under DADT.

During the first week of their fall senior semester, Sophie Moore, Kate's roommate and girlfriend, takes her up on an offer Kate made to her at the end of Well-Matched: a private boxing rematch.
